Remarks on exactness notions pertaining to pushouts
Abstract
We call a finitely complete category diexact if every Mal'cev relation admits a pushout which is stable under pullback and itself a pullback. We prove three results relating to diexact categories: firstly, that a category is a pretopos if and only if it is diexact with a strict initial object; secondly, that a category is diexact if and only if it is Barr-exact, and every pair of monomorphisms admits a pushout which is stable and a pullback; and thirdly, that a small category with finite limits and pushouts of Mal'cev spans is diexact if and only if it admits a full structure-preserving embedding into a Grothendieck topos.
Turn this paper into a lesson
ArcXiv compiles a structured reading guide from this paper's metadata: plain-English importance, contributions, prerequisite concepts, which sections to read first, flashcards, and a quiz. Grounded in the abstract, never invented.